Ticket #— Floor 9 Opening Prep, Brindlemoor House

Hi facilities folks, Floor 9 opens to staff next Monday and we need a few things squared away before then. Lift access is live, but the two side doors by the kitchenette are still on the old lock config — please reprogram them before Friday. Also, signage for the quiet rooms hasn't arrived, so pop up the temporary printed ones for now. Until the badge readers sync, the interim door code for Floor 9 is below.

door code, bajop-bajog: bdg-DSWAC-43621

Soft deletes on the Quellmart orders table set deleted_at; rows are never hard-removed by app code. The nightly Reaper job purges rows older than 90 days. Never query orders without filtering deleted_at IS NULL — the ORM does this only via the OrderScope mixin. If counts look wrong, check for raw SQL bypassing the scope. Full purge schedule and exemption list are on the internal page here.

wiki page, tahaf-tajog: https://jira.ordindyn.corp/pipeline

## Runbook: SquatterWatch scanner restart

Hey, welcome aboard! If SquatterWatch stops flagging look-alike package names, first check the feed puller — nine times out of ten it's just a stale mirror of the Pellmont registry. Restart the puller, wait five minutes, then run the smoke query against a known typo-squat fixture. If it still comes up empty, escalate to the Drayfield crew rather than poking the matcher config yourself. When you escalate, paste the scanner's current build token, shown right below.

session token of bajog-tadup = htk3_ffc